My Buying Guides on 5.50 16 Tractor Tire

What I Look for First

When I shop for a 5.50 16 tractor tire, the first thing I check is whether it matches my tractor’s wheel size exactly. I always confirm the rim diameter, tire width, and overall fit before anything else. If the size is off, the tire won’t perform properly, even if it looks similar.

My Main Considerations Before Buying

I focus on a few key points before making a purchase:

  • Tread pattern: I choose a tread that matches my work conditions, whether I need better grip in mud, soil, or general farm use.
  • Load capacity: I make sure the tire can handle the weight of my tractor and the tasks I use it for.
  • Durability: I prefer tires made with strong rubber compounds because I want them to last through rough terrain.
  • Tube type or tubeless: I always check whether my tractor needs a tube-type tire or a tubeless one.

Where I Plan to Use It

My buying choice depends a lot on where I use my tractor most. If I work on soft ground, I look for a tire with deeper tread for better traction. If I use my tractor on harder surfaces or for lighter farm duties, I may choose a tire that offers smoother handling and less wear.

How I Check Compatibility

I never assume a tire will fit just because the size looks close. I compare the 5.50 16 tire specifications with my current tire and wheel setup. I also check:

  • Rim width
  • Overall tire diameter
  • Clearance around the wheel well
  • Recommended inflation pressure

My Preference for Quality and Brand

I usually pay attention to brand reputation and customer reviews. A trusted brand gives me more confidence in the tire’s performance and lifespan. I also look for signs of good workmanship, such as even tread design and sturdy sidewalls.

What I Consider About Price

I try not to focus only on the cheapest option. In my experience, a low-priced tire may wear out faster or perform poorly under load. I compare price with durability, traction, and warranty so I can get better value for my money.

My Final Tip Before Buying

Before I place my order, I double-check the product description, measurements, and return policy. I also make sure I know whether the tire comes with a tube or if I need to buy one separately. That way, I avoid installation problems and extra costs later.
